Lake Placid dropped their record down to 11-5 on Wednesday, which also ended the team's three-game streak of wins. They came up short against the North Warren Central Cougars, falling 15-8. For those keeping track at home, that's the biggest loss the Bombers have suffered since April 27, 2024.
Lake Placid saw six different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Jarrett Mihill, who went 3-for-4 with two runs, two doubles, and one RBI.
As for North Warren Central, the victory was the sixth in a row for them, bringing their record up to 13-5-1. Considering they have won seven matchups by more than six runs this season, Wednesday's blowout was nothing new.
On North Warren Central's side, Wyatt Jennings made a big impact no matter where he played. He looked comfortable on the mound, striking out 11 batters over 6.2 innings while giving up seven earned (and one unearned) runs off ten hits. Jennings has been consistent: he hasn't given up more than two walks in five consecutive appearances. He was also big at the plate, going 1-for-5 with two runs, one stolen base, and one double. He has become a key player for North Warren Central: the team is undefeated when he posts at least two runs, but 4-5-1 otherwise.
In other batting news, CJ Barlow was a standout: he went 3-for-4 with three RBI, two runs, and one double. Those three RBI gave him a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Maceo Matson, who went 3-for-6 with three RBI, one stolen base, and one run.
Lake Placid does not have any more games scheduled as of now. As for North Warren Central, they will square off against Parishville-Hopkinton at 2:00 p.m. on Saturday. The Panthers will roll in looking for their ninth straight win, something the Cougars surely won't give up without a fight.
